What is Ultrasound Imaging?

Ultrasound imaging is a diagnostic technique that utilizes sound waves to create images of soft tissues in the body. It is particularly useful in assessing structures such as muscles, tendons, and ligaments. When your ultrasound report mentions that it shows ‘scar tissue stable,’ it indicates that the scar tissue in the identified area appears to be unchanged in terms of size and appearance over time. This usually means that the scar tissue is not actively affecting your body’s function or causing symptoms. However, it is important to remember that while ultrasound can provide valuable insights into soft tissue conditions, it does not measure pain levels or predict recovery outcomes.

Understanding Scar Tissue Development

If your ultrasound report indicates that scar tissue is stable, it generally means that the fibrous tissue formed during the healing process is not currently changing or worsening. Scar tissue can develop after an injury, surgery, or inflammation, and its presence is a normal part of the body’s healing mechanism. In many cases, stable scar tissue does not significantly affect your ability to move or engage in regular activities. However, its impact on function can vary depending on its location and the overall condition of the surrounding tissues. It’s also important to understand that while ultrasound can visualize the physical presence of scar tissue, it does not measure symptoms or the overall recovery trajectory. Many individuals may experience scar tissue without any pain or limitations, and it is common for the body to adapt to these changes effectively.
